I've been trying to download IE6 SP1 for a Windows 98 PC. The pc only has a
56k modem so I'm using the download-only method to get the appropriate full
version from a faster internet connection.

I've been using the command

"location_of_setup_file\ie6setup.exe" /c:"ie6wzd.exe /d /s:""#E"

documented in the microsoft knowledge base. However when I select the
'Windows 98' option then click next, the program breifly shows a downloading
animation and then exits. When I run the command again it takes me back to
the start of the procedure again and the same thing happens.

I've done this before (maybe not with sp1, but another version of ie) and
it's worked great. I'm executing the command on a windows xp pc.

Anyone any ideas why it's not working?

Why not just find the file on the Windows Update Catalog
site, right click to save as and point it to a folder you
can create on the desktop or elsewhere. After the download
is complete, burn that folder to a CD.
